Zaloguj się lub zarejestruj. 21 Listopad 2024, godz.23:01

Autor Wątek: eksport 3ds do rhino  (Przeczytany 3722 razy)

ledman

  • Gość
eksport 3ds do rhino
« dnia: 11 Sierpień 2008, godz.20:48 »
Witam,
Mam dość dziwny problem z eksportem 3dsow do rhino , mianowicie wydaje mi sie ze powierchnie z 3ds "uwypuklaja" sie lekko przez co  przy renderze tworza sie lekkie dodatkowe cienie . Wydaje mi się , że wystarczy zmniejszyc liczbe trojkatów modelu? Może ktoś ma inny pomysł? Jak tego uniknąc?Poniżej pare screenów z problemu


pozdrawiam

Offline Odyniec

  • Administrator
  • Forum Ekspert
  • *****
  • Wiadomości: 1545
  • Reputacja na forum: +125/-1
  • Autoryzowany Instruktor Rhinoceros
Odp: eksport 3ds do rhino
« Odpowiedź #1 dnia: 11 Sierpień 2008, godz.21:28 »
W przypadku formatu 3ds - trudno mówić o jakiekolwiek kontroli, czy przewidywalnym zachowaniu. Ten format obsługuje maksymalnie coś około 60 tys trójkątów i powstał jeszcze w czasach, gdy królowały pogramy pod DOS, a nie Windows, z pewnością mocno w poprzednim wieku . Używaj OBJ, a jak będą problemy - wtedy pisz, o 3ds - zapomnij w ogóle i na zawsze.

ps. Istnieje "podrasowana" wersja tego formatu, ale Rhino jej nie obsługuje poprawnie.
« Ostatnia zmiana: 11 Sierpień 2008, godz.21:32 wysłana przez Odyniec »

Offline satrab

  • Forum Ekspert
  • *****
  • Wiadomości: 635
  • Reputacja na forum: +138/-0
Odp: eksport 3ds do rhino
« Odpowiedź #2 dnia: 11 Sierpień 2008, godz.21:33 »
Odyniec ma racje, 3ds to taki trochę kłopotliwy/upierdliwy format, i bardzo często występuje z nim taki problem jaki Ty masz. Coś mi świta w głowie, że miałem na to jakiś sposób ale nie mogę sobie w tej chwili przypomnieć  ::)

Offline Jarek

  • Doświadczony użytkownik
  • **
  • Wiadomości: 72
  • Reputacja na forum: +147/-0
    • RhinoScripted Tools
Odp: eksport 3ds do rhino
« Odpowiedź #3 dnia: 12 Sierpień 2008, godz.05:02 »
Przy imporcie roznych formatow siatek ( mesh ), w tym 3ds, Rhino domyslnie traktuje wszystkie pokrywajace sie punkty jako polaczone ( weld ).
W rezultacie przy wyslwietlaniu albo renderingu widoczny jest efekt dodatkowego cieniowania.

Komenda "_Unweld" powinna pomoc.
Sprobuj "_Unweld 20" ( wartosc to kat tolerancji wygladzania ).


ledman

  • Gość
Odp: eksport 3ds do rhino
« Odpowiedź #4 dnia: 12 Sierpień 2008, godz.09:17 »
Zapisanie pliku w OBJ i komenda _unweld bardzo mi pomogła a w zasadzie rozwiązała problem :-*

dziękuję za szybką odpowiedz

______________________
pozdrawiam